The Importance Of Getting A Chlamydia Test In The UK

Chlamydia is one of the most common sexually transmitted infections (STIs) in the UK, with thousands of new cases diagnosed each year It is caused by the bacteria Chlamydia trachomatis and can affect both men and women Many people with chlamydia do not experience any symptoms, which is why getting tested regularly is crucial In this article, we will discuss the importance of getting a chlamydia test in the UK and how easy it is to do so.

Chlamydia can have serious consequences if left untreated In women, it can lead to pelvic inflammatory disease (PID), which can cause infertility and chronic pelvic pain In men, untreated chlamydia can cause epididymitis, a painful condition that affects the testicles Additionally, chlamydia can increase the risk of contracting other STIs, such as HIV This is why early detection and treatment are key in preventing these complications.

Getting tested for chlamydia in the UK is simple and confidential There are several options available for testing, including visiting a sexual health clinic, a GP, or ordering a home testing kit online Many sexual health clinics offer free and confidential testing for chlamydia and other STIs These clinics have trained professionals who can answer any questions you may have and provide you with the necessary treatment if your test comes back positive.

If you prefer to test from the comfort of your own home, you can order a chlamydia test kit online These kits are discreet and easy to use, usually involving a urine sample or a swab of your genitals Once you have collected your sample, you can send it off to a laboratory for testing The results are typically available within a few days, and if your test comes back positive, you can receive treatment discreetly through the post.

However, anyone who is sexually active, regardless of age, should consider getting tested regularly Many people with chlamydia do not experience any symptoms, so getting tested is the only way to know for sure if you are infected.

In the UK, chlamydia testing is free for those under the age of 25 However, if you are older than 25 or prefer to test privately, there are several options available to you Many private clinics offer chlamydia testing for a fee, and some pharmacies also sell home testing kits These kits are convenient for those who are unable to visit a clinic in person or would prefer to test from the comfort of their own home.

If you test positive for chlamydia, it is important to seek treatment right away Chlamydia is easily treatable with antibiotics, and the sooner you start treatment, the less likely you are to experience complications Your healthcare provider can prescribe the appropriate medication, which you can either pick up from a pharmacy or have delivered to your home.

In addition to seeking treatment for yourself, it is important to inform your sexual partners if you test positive for chlamydia This will allow them to get tested and treated if necessary, preventing the spread of the infection It is also recommended to abstain from sexual activity until you have completed your treatment and have been advised by a healthcare professional that it is safe to resume.
